1. 程式人生 > 其它 >docker-compose 搭建 YOURLS 短網址服務

docker-compose 搭建 YOURLS 短網址服務

原文地址:https://www.jianshu.com/p/219facf22b74

安裝 docker 和 docker-compose 教程:https://www.cnblogs.com/CyLee/p/16152715.html


 

個人補充的配置:

docker-compose.yml
version: '3.1'

services:

  yourls:
    image: yourls
    restart: always
    ports:
      - 8088:80
    environment:
      YOURLS_DB_HOST: 43.154.108.138:3307
      YOURLS_DB_PASS: 
123456789 YOURLS_SITE: http://43.154.108.138:8088 YOURLS_USER: test YOURLS_PASS: test mysql: image: mysql:5.7 restart: always ports: - "3307:3306" environment: MYSQL_ROOT_PASSWORD: 123456789 MYSQL_DATABASE: yourls

 

啟動

docker-compose up -d

 

補充:記得騰訊雲後臺防火牆新增 8088和3307埠號

 

檢視服務:http://43.154.108.138:8088/admin

 

外掛:

預設遞增id,可以開啟外掛來隨機網址

 

 

 

正式使用,生成短連結

 

生成成功!

此時訪問 http://43.154.107.137:8088/qvp1x 就會自動跳轉到 http://www.baidu.com 。